Resolution 2013.12.09 R02 Water Rates

Date Posted: Thursday, December 12th, 2013

The Town Council meeting on December 9th, resolution #2013.12.09 R02 A Resolution adopting the rates to be charged for the supply of water, was passed unanimously.  Please click on the link to view the resolution. 2013.12.09R02 Water Rates. The new water rates are $21.50 which include up to 2000 gallons and $6.15 per thousand gallons after.  The rates are effective for the January usage which will be billed in February.  It is important to note that the town’s water rates are based on an equivalent dwelling unit (EDU).  For those apartments and duplexes that only have one water meter you will be charged the per EDU rate for every unit in your complex/duplex. National Prescription Drug "Take-Back" Day Saturday October 26th, 2013

Date Posted: Friday, October 25th, 2013

National Prescription Drug “Take-Back” Day Saturday October 26th, 2013 The U.S.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) and local law enforcement agencies are working together to sponsor National Prescription Drug “take-back” day tomorrow Saturday, October 26th, 2013. Between 10:00 am and 2:00 pm designated police agencies will accept any outdated or unused medications for proper disposal. Flushing or tossing away the medication in the trash is not recommended since many drugs can persist an cause environment damage. They can also impair the proper operation of septic systems. Experts say periodically disposing of unneeded prescriptions reduces the chances of abuse of confusing medications.  According to DEA officials, over half of teens abusing medicines get them from a family member or friend, often without their knowledge.
